Marie Denise Pelletier is a Canadian francophone singer-songwriter from Montreal, Quebec. Active since 1982, she has released multiple studio albums, performed in Quebec’s music scene, and served as president of Artisti, a music rights collective affiliated with the Union des artistes. She is known for songs including "Pour une histoire d’un soir" and "Tous les cris les SOS".

Music career
Pelletier began her professional career in 1982 and has released 12 studio albums since 1986. She is known in Quebec and other French-speaking markets for her pop and adult contemporary repertoire.
Awards and recognition
Her career includes 19 Prix Félix nominations and two wins. She won in 1994 for pop album of the year and again in 2022 for performance of the year with Joe Bocan and Marie Carmen.
Arts administration
Pelletier served as president of Artisti, a Canadian licensing body associated with the Union des artistes. Her administrative work is a notable part of her public career.
